Как работают базы данных и серверы

Как работают базы данных и серверы

Актуальные виртуальные системы действуют благодаря связи двух основных компонентов. Машины обрабатывают обращения пользователей и производят расчеты. Базы данных записывают информацию в структурированном формате. Осознание основ функционирования способствует освоить в принципах работы вавада зеркало электронных сервисов и приложений.

Почему за каждым сайтом и приложением находится невидимая структура

Пользователи наблюдают только интерфейс приложения или сайта. За визуальной обёрткой таится сложная инженерная структура. Серверное оборудование располагается в дата-центрах и гарантирует бесперебойную деятельность системы. Системы хранения сведений включают миллионы сведений о юзерах, транзакциях и содержимом.

Инфраструктура осуществляет критично важные функции. Она обслуживает приходящие обращения от тысяч клиентов одновременно. Части архитектуры верифицируют полномочия доступа и защищают секретную данные. вавада казино координирует сотрудничество между различными блоками программы. Без устойчивой технологической фундамента невозможно разработать надёжный виртуальный сервис.

Что такое сервер и зачем он необходим цифровому решению

Машина представляет собой машину с высокой мощностью, который обрабатывает запросы клиентских устройств. Системное ПО управляет доступом к средствам и распределяет трафик. вавада казино отвечает за механизмы функционирования приложения и связь с системами сведений. Без серверной элемента невозможна деятельность современных веб-сервисов.

Как база данных сохраняет сведения и помогает оперативно ее отыскивать

Хранилище данных упорядочивает сведения в таблицы, файлы или графы. Структурированное хранение даёт быстро извлекать нужные записи. vavada casino применяет специальные алгоритмы для улучшения доступа к данным.

Эффективность деятельности обеспечивается несколькими инструментами:

  • Индексы генерируют ссылки на постоянно востребованные информацию
  • Кэширование записывает востребованные требования в кэше
  • Партиционирование делит большие таблицы на фрагменты
  • Репликация дублирует информацию на несколько машин

Корректная архитектура базы уменьшает длительность отклика и увеличивает эффективность приложения.

Что происходит, когда клиент запускает портал или приложение

Пользовательское оборудование посылает обращение на сервер через интернет. Обращение несёт информацию о нужной странице или действии. Сервер изучает запрос и устанавливает нужные данные для отклика.

Платформа обращается к базе для получения требуемых данных. vavada casino осуществляет запрос по определённым критериям и выдаёт данные. Машина обрабатывает информацию и генерирует веб-страницу или JSON-ответ. Готовый итог отправляется на гаджет пользователя. Браузер или сервис показывает сведения на дисплее. Весь цикл требует фрагменты секунды при корректной настройке.

Соединение между машиной, базой данных и клиентским интерфейсом

Клиентский оболочка является внешнюю сторону приложения. Кнопки и элементы посылают инструкции на серверную сторону. Сервер выступает связующим между юзером и хранилищем информации. Он получает требования и генерирует команды к сведениям.

вавада получает требуемую информацию из таблиц. Сервер трансформирует итоги в формат для клиентского сервиса. Информация поступают в оболочку для показа. Трёхслойная организация делит функции между элементами. Такое деление облегчает разработку и обслуживание сервиса. Каждый компонент изменяется независимо от остальных частей.

Почему данные следует не лишь содержать, а корректно структурировать

Неструктурированное распределение данных влечёт к медленной деятельности системы. Поиск нужной данных среди миллионов объектов отнимает значительное срок. Корректная структура повышает доступ и снижает загрузку на технику.

Нормализация убирает повторение и экономит дисковое объём. Связи между таблицами поддерживают целостность сведений. вавада поддерживает целостность данных при параллельных обновлениях. Индексирование главных полей формирует оперативные каналы доступа. Грамотная организация базы увеличивает стабильность и производительность всего сервиса.

Реляционные и нереляционные базы данных: в чем различие на применении

Реляционные системы организуют информацию в таблицы со жёсткой схемой. Соединения между таблицами гарантируют непротиворечивость информации. Язык SQL обеспечивает осуществлять запутанные команды и соединять информацию из разных баз.

Нереляционные решения задействуют гибкие структуры размещения. Документоориентированные платформы сохраняют информацию в JSON-структурах. Графовые системы заточены для работы со связями между сущностями.

вавада казино определяется в соответствии от нужд системы. Реляционные применимы для операционных платформ с четкой структурой. Нереляционные предоставляют масштабируемость и пластичность схемы сведений.

Как команды позволяют извлекать нужную сведения из базы

Запросы составляют собой инструкции для выборки или изменения данных. Язык SQL даёт формулировать критерии поиска и отбора элементов. Платформа определяет оптимальный путь исполнения команды.

Основные категории манипуляций с данными:

  • Выборка записей по указанным критериям
  • Внесение дополнительных данных в таблицы
  • Обновление существующих параметров
  • Ликвидация неактуальной информации

vavada casino улучшает выполнение обращений с посредством индексов. Сложные обращения соединяют данные из ряда таблиц. Агрегатные операции определяют общие и арифметические значения. Корректно составленные обращения увеличивают доставку результатов.

Значение API в передаче информацией между приложениями

API представляет системный механизм для связи между приложениями. Механизм устанавливает принципы передачи информацией и структуры отправки сведений. Сервисы задействуют API для извлечения возможностей сторонних сервисов.

REST API работает через HTTP-протокол и использует стандартные способы запросов. Клиент передаёт запрос с аргументами. Сервер выполняет запрос и возвращает ответ в формате JSON. вавада предоставляет данные через API для сторонних программ.

Механизмы позволяют подключать финансовые системы, карты и общественные платформы. Программисты разрабатывают модульные приложения с связью через API. Такой метод ускоряет рост системы.

Почему быстродействие сервера влияет на деятельность всего продукта

Период ответа сервера определяет скорость отображения веб-страниц и исполнения команд. Замедленная обслуживание команд снижает эффективность. Каждая избыточная секунда простоя поднимает уровень прерываний.

Скорость оборудования воздействует на число параллельно обрабатываемых обращений. Недостаточная мощность процессора порождает скопления и простои. Оперативная ОЗУ сдерживает величину кэшируемых данных.

Оптимизация программы улучшает результативность работы. Производительный машина гарантирует удобное взаимодействие с приложением. Эффективность архитектуры воздействует на довольство юзеров и успешность продукта.

Как машины обрабатывают с значительным количеством клиентов

Рост пользователей формирует возросшую трафик на архитектуру. Один сервер не в_состоянии обслуживать миллионы команд параллельно. Системы задействуют различные методы для балансировки трафика.

Горизонтальное масштабирование подключает новые узлы. Балансировщик разделяет приходящие запросы между машинами. Каждый узел обслуживает фрагмент трафика. Вертикальное масштабирование увеличивает силу техники.

Объединения функционируют как общая платформа и предоставляют стабильность. При сбое единственной узла другие продолжают обслуживать пользователей. Корректная структура позволяет выполнять возрастающий трафик без ухудшения уровня.

Масштабирование трафика

Балансировка команд между несколькими узлами вавада избегает перегрузку архитектуры. Балансировщик анализирует актуальную занятость серверов и перенаправляет поток на меньше загруженные машины. Автоматизированное добавление узлов выполняется при росте объёма клиентов. Система масштабируется в зависимости от актуальной нужды в вычислительных средствах.

Кэширование и распределение запросов

Кэш записывает постоянно популярные данные в оперативной памяти. Вторичные обращения к сведениям не нуждаются обращений к хранилищу. Распределённый буфер находится на множестве серверах для расширения ёмкости. CDN предоставляет фиксированный контент из близких к юзеру точек. Такие инструменты сокращают трафик на главную архитектуру и повышают ответ архитектуры.

Сохранность данных: охрана, запасные копии и надзор входа

Оборона данных предполагает интегрированного метода на всех уровнях платформы. Кодирование информации исключает несанкционированный вход при перехвате данных. Протоколы охраны вавада казино гарантируют секретность отправки данных.

Платформа надзора входа сдерживает права юзеров в соответствии от статуса. Аутентификация проверяет легитимность пользовательских профилей. Периодическое создание запасных дубликатов оберегает от пропажи сведений при сбоях.

Бэкапы находятся на независимых машинах или в виртуальных репозиториях. Программное копирование производится по графику. Процедуры восстановления обеспечивают быстро возобновить функциональность системы.

Что происходит при отказах и как платформы восстанавливаются

Аппаратные сбои случаются по различным основаниям: выход аппаратуры, дефекты софта, перегрузка сети. Платформы наблюдения проверяют положение модулей и сигнализируют о неполадках. Автоматические инструменты запускают процедуры реанимации.

Главные стадии реанимации дееспособности:

  • Выявление неполадки через мониторинг
  • Передача потока на запасные узлы
  • Реанимация сведений из дубликатов
  • Устранение неисправности

Репликация информации на ряд узлов поддерживает непрерывность работы. При поломке отдельного машины система использует дублирующие бэкапы. Время восстановления обусловлено от структуры архитектуры.

Почему базы данных и серверы остаются базисом виртуального окружения

Каждый нынешний электронный сервис требует устойчивого размещения и обработки информации. Машины vavada casino выполняют вычисления и синхронизируют работу сервисов. Репозитории сведений гарантируют оперативный доступ к записям. Развитие технологий не исключает основополагающие основы структуры. Понимание функционирования системы способствует создавать производительные и гибкие системы.

Posted in blog.